What is a Flexible Spending Account and how can it help my non-
profit?
• A way to save money on day care and health care services as
well as over-the-counter items for you and your family!
• An account where you contribute money deducted from your sal-
ary, before taxes are withheld, incur eligible expenses and get
reimbursed
• A way to pay less in taxes and save more money for employees
and the organization.

What is it?
Running a nonprofit is serious business that warrants knowledge-
able legal consultation from time to time. Whether it is a personnel
matter or a question on conflict of interest, the NYCON provides our
member agencies with independent, expert, and low-cost assistance
from attorneys who practice exclusively in nonprofit law. Assistance
is available in the creation or modification of personnel polices, by-
laws and other important corporate documents, such as contracts
and leases; assistance in the completion of various Tax Exemption
Applications; Incorporation and Amendments; Advocacy and lobby-
ing regulations; confidentiality and conflict of interest issues; estab-
lishing subsidiaries and other related entities; assistance with merg-
ers, consolidations and corporate dissolutions; etc.

Ombudsman Program
What is it?
Working in conjunction with the NYS Comptroller, NYCON is now
taking online inquiries from members regarding their unresolved
contracting or payment issues the state. The program will provide
nonprofit members with:
• Education on all of the requirements needed on the organiza-
tion’s part in order to obtain contracts and payments in a timely
manner.
• Information on the specific location of their contract or payment
voucher.
• Assistance in steering and facilitating their contract or payment
voucher so that it can be received in a timely manner.
